Output 8bd8b64e85c875a1c2d39b037fb5d3e99ef7fddf14966a76106ea0cd2b27d2ce:1

value
1509649
script pubkey
OP_0 OP_PUSHBYTES_20 65b59f23f854b343036b12f1e268ab577782120d
address
bc1qvk6e7glc2je5xqmtztc7y69t2amcyysdfu83dv
transaction
8bd8b64e85c875a1c2d39b037fb5d3e99ef7fddf14966a76106ea0cd2b27d2ce